2. Explore the stunning Ermoupolis Town Hall, designed by architect Ernst Ziller

The Town Hall of Ermoupolis stands as a stunning example of neoclassical architecture. Built between 1864 and 1896, it showcases the talent of architect Ernst Ziller. The building’s grand facade and intricate details mesmerize visitors.

Inside, you can find beautiful rooms filled with history. The main hall, adorned with elegant decorations, often hosts local events and gatherings. Guided tours are available to provide insights into its history and architecture.

3. Stroll through the picturesque streets of Vaporia, known for its neoclassical mansions

Vaporia is the charming area of Ermoupolis filled with stunning neoclassical mansions. Walking through these streets feels like stepping back in time. The beautiful homes showcase elaborate facades and vibrant colors.

As you stroll, take your time to admire the details of each building. Many of them have fascinating histories tied to the maritime trade and wealth of their former owners. The architecture reflects the island’s prosperous past.

4. Visit the Syros Industrial Museum to learn about the island’s maritime history

The Syros Industrial Museum is a must-see for anyone interested in the island’s maritime heritage. Housed in a former Tannery, the museum showcases the industrial revolution and its impact on Syros. It tells the story of the island’s growth in a fascinating way.

As you enter, you’ll find various exhibits displaying machinery and historical artifacts. Each item tells a part of Syros’s story, from shipbuilding to textiles. The museum is well-curated, making it easy to navigate and learn.
